Overview Brightree is the market leader in business management and optimization software solutions in the post-acute care space. As we aspire to hold our leading position, we focus on delivering modern, relevant, and easy to adopt solutions by standardizing offerings, value propositions, pricing and delivery processes. Productizing our software and services will enable us to be more efficient, scalable, and to support rapid digital and patient-centric transformation in the post-acute care space.

This is a highly visible role and a great opportunity for an experienced technical product manager, or product owner, to influence the execution of the Digital Experience portfolio strategy.

Responsibilities

Collaborate with stakeholders and users to understand business needs and requirements

Develop new products and features, test their performance, and iterate quickly

Partner with engineering teams and leaders to ensure that designers, engineers, QA, and others are operating effectively at all levels

Create mock-ups, wireframes, and workflow diagrams

Help identify business value, understand required use cases and capabilities, and translate these into product requirements

Write clear user stories and establish acceptance criteria based on requirements

Research functional, regulatory, or security needs in a specific area to develop the business requirements and processes

Document customer requirements

Required Skills/Experience

Successfully launched a cloud solution at an enterprise SaaS company

3+ years in a market-facing product management role defining and delivering enterprise-class cloud software on web or mobile platforms

1+ years of experience in healthcare IT, or a healthcare software development organization

Bachelor’s degree in a technical or business-related field, or equivalent experience building and shipping software

Strong collaboration and communication skills, including the ability to convey ideas to healthcare IT audiences

Strong knowledge and experience with Agile/Scrum/Kanban and related tools (Jira)

Understanding and technical acumen on core cloud concepts such as SaaS, APIs, DevOps/SRE, and/or artificial intelligence/machine learning

Experience driving product vision, strategic product roadmaps, go-to-market strategy, product ops, and design discussions

Experience establishing and maintaining trust-based relationships with cross-functional teams, particularly Engineering, UX/UI, Sales, Customer Support, Finance or Marketing

5-10% travel

Ability to influence multiple stakeholders without direct authority

Preferred Skills/Experience

Knowledge of the Home Health, Home Medical Equipment, or Order Fulfillment markets

Experience managing day-to-day technical and design direction

Experience or background with workflow automation technologies

Benefits and Compensation We are shaping the future at ResMed, and we recognize the need to build on and broaden our existing skills and continue to attract and retain the world’s best talent. We offer holistic benefits packages, flexible work arrangements, and competitive salaries. Employees scheduled to work 30 or more hours per week are eligible for benefits. This position qualifies for the following benefits package: comprehensive medical, vision, dental, and life, AD&D, short-term and long-term disability insurance, sleep care management, Health Savings Account (HSA), Flexible Spending Account (FSA), commuter benefits, 401(k), Employee Stock Purchase Plan (ESPP), Employee Assistance Program (EAP), and tuition assistance. Employees accrue three weeks of Paid Time Off (PTO) in their first year of employment, receive 11 paid holidays plus 3 floating days, and are eligible for 14 weeks of primary caregiver or two weeks of secondary caregiver leave when welcoming new family members. Individual pay decisions are based on factors such as geographic location, qualifications, experience, and skills.

Base Pay Range For This Position

Base pay range: 118,000 - 148,000 - 178,000. For remote positions located outside of the US, pay will be determined based on the candidate’s geographic location, qualifications, and experience.
